Why the Skepticism? Understanding Small Business Owners’ Concerns About Digital Marketing

BuzzBoard

Reasons Small Business Owners Show Skepticism Towards Digital Marketing Many small business owners harbor skepticism about digital marketing and its potential benefits. This skepticism often stems from the perceived steep learning curve of digital marketing, as well as the challenge of establishing trust with customers online.
